MISCELLANEOUS LOCATION

Component Location
AM-FM Antenna Right rear of vehicle. See Figure.
Audio Amplifier Under center console.
Blower Motor Resistor Assembly On HVAC module. See Figure.
Blower Motor Resistor Assembly (Auxiliary) Mounted to auxiliary HVAC box, below blower motor. See Figure.
Blower Motor Resistor Assembly Connector On HVAC module. See Figure.
Body Harness Right rocker panel. See Figure.
Camper Wiring Harness Left rear frame rail. See Figure.
Camper Wiring Harness Connector Left rear frame rail. See Figure.
Data Link Connector Below left side of dash. See Figure.
Digital Radio Receiver Behind right side of dash. See Figure.
Digital Radio Receiver Connector Behind right side of dash. See Figure.
Driver Power Seat Harness Below driver's seat. See Figure.
Emergency Roof Lamp Harness Left "B" pillar. See Figure.
Engine Coil Connector (8.1L) (Right) Top right side of engine. See Figure.
Engine Coil Harness Connector (8.1L) (Right) Top or right valve cover. See Figure.
Engine Harness (4.8L, 5.3L & 6.0L) Engine compartment. See Figure.
Engine Harness (8.1L) Rear of engine compartment. See Figure.
FM Antenna Left rear of vehicle. See Figure.
Heated Seat Element Connector (Driver Cushion) On driver's heated seat cushion element. See Figure.
Heated Seat Element (Driver Cushion) In driver's seat cushion. See Figure.
Heated Seat Element (Right Front Cushion) In right front seat cushion. See Figure.
Horn (High Note) Right side of radiator support. See Figure.
Horn (Low Note) Left side of radiator support. See Figure.
HVAC Harness (Auxiliary) Right rear of vehicle. See Figure.
Ignition Coil Connector (Component Side) (8.1L) Center of right valve cover. See Figure.
Ignition Coil Connector (Harness Side) (8.1L) Center of right valve cover. See Figure.
Ignition Coils (Left Bank) On top of left valve covers. See Figure.
Ignition Coil 2 (4.8L, 5.3L & 6.0L) Right side of engine. See Figure.
Ignition Coil 4 (4.8L, 5.3L & 6.0L) Right side of engine. See Figure.
Ignition Coil 6 (4.8L, 5.3L & 6.0L) Right side of engine. See Figure.
Ignition Coil 8 (4.8L, 5.3L & 6.0L) Right side of engine. See Figure.
Inflatable Restraint I/P Module Right side of instrument panel. See Figure.
Inflatable Restraint Side Impact Module (Left) On side of left front seat back. See Figure.
Inflatable Restraint Side Impact Module (Right) On side of right front seat back. See Figure.
Inflatable Restraint Steering Wheel Module On steering wheel. See Figure.
Inflatable Restraint Steering Wheel Module Coil Below steering wheel module. See Figure.
Instrument Panel Extension Harness Left kick panel. See Figure.
Liftgate Latch Connector In liftgate. See Figure.
Liftgate Lower Latch Connector In liftgate. See Figure.
Negative Battery Cable (G100) Left front of engine compartment. See Figure.
Trailer Wiring Connector Center rear of vehicle. See Figure.
Trailer Wiring Receptacle Center rear of vehicle. See Figure.
Wiper Motor Connector (Rear) In center of lift gate. See Figure.

When to See a Mechanic

Stop DIY work and contact a certified mechanic immediately if any of the following apply:

  • You smell fuel, burning insulation, or see smoke.
  • Brakes feel soft, pull hard to one side, or make grinding noises.
  • The engine overheats, stalls repeatedly, or misfires under load.
  • You are missing required tools, torque specs, or safe lifting equipment.
  • You are not confident in the next step or safety outcome.
